Abstract

The present invention relates to an apparatus for detecting signals from a human or animal living body, which apparatus, during operation, performs the following steps: time-dependently detecting a signal 200, 610 from a human or animal living body; subdividing a signal segment 201 into first blocks 210; determining the total number of first blocks 210; determining a measure 220, 320, 420 of the signal amplitude in each of the first blocks 210; and is less than a predeterminable first threshold 330, 430, calculate a first quotient q1 from the number of first blocks 210 whose signal amplitude measure 220, 320, 420 is less than the first threshold 330, 430 and the total number of first blocks 210, compare the first quotient q1 with a second threshold 350, 450, and classify the state of the human or animal organism as physiological or pathophysiological as a function of the previous comparison.
